To display the IPv6 ACL page, click Security ACL > Advanced IPv6 ACL.
1. IPv6 ACL is the IPv6 ACL Name string which includes up to 31 alphanumeric characters
only. The name must start with an alphabetic character.
2. Click Add to add a new IPv6
ACL to the switch configuration.
3. Click Apply to send the updated configuration to the switch. Configuration changes take
ef
fect immediately.
4. Click Cancel to cancel the configuration on the screen and reset the data on the screen to
the latest value of the switch.
5. Click Delete to remove the currently selected IPv6
ACL from the switch configuration.
Field Description
Current Number of ACL The current number of the IP ACLs configured on the
switch.
Maximum ACL The maximum number of IP ACL that can be
configured on the switch, it depends on the
hardware.
Rules The number of the rules associated with the IP ACL.
Type The type is IPv6 ACL.
IPv6 Rules
Use these screens to display the rules for the IPv6 Access Control Lists, which are created
using the IPv6 Access Control List Configuration screen. By default, no specific value is in
effect for any of the IPv6 ACL rules.
To display the IPv6 Rules page, click Security
ACL > Advanced IPv6 Rules.
